How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Arlington County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Arlington County Studio Apartments | $2,166 | $1,020 | $4,500 |
| Arlington County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,600 | $835 | $7,754 |
| Arlington County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,443 | $977 | $10,000+ |
| Arlington County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,971 | $1,060 | $10,000+ |
| Arlington County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,861 | $1,050 | $9,046 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Arlington County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Arlington County?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Arlington County is at The Shelton listed at $1,020.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Arlington County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Arlington County is $3,822.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Arlington County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Arlington County is a 2,846 square feet unit starting from $2,612 at The Point at Falls Church.
What is the average size for Arlington County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Arlington County is currently at 578 sq ft.
